How much do program coordinator program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for program coordinator program manager in Hamden, CT is $56,964.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$44,700.00 and $66,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Program Coordinators and Program Managers?

Program Coordinators and Program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ing and organizing specific programs within an organization. A Program Coordinator typically handles the day-to-day operations, logistics, and administrative tasks of a program, ensuring activities run smoothly. A Program Manager, on the other hand, often has broader responsibilities, including strategic planning, managing budgets, leading teams, and evaluating program effectiveness. Both roles are essential for achieving the goals and objectives of organizational programs.

How does a Program Coordinator or Program Man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ams?

Program Coordinators and Program Managers regularly work with cross-functional teams, including departments like finance, marketing, operations, and human resources. They serve as the central point of communication, ensuring that project milestones are met and that everyone is aligned with program goals. This collaboration often involves organizing meetings, facilitating updates, and resolving any interdepartmental challenges that arise. Strong interpersonal and organizational skills are essential for managing these interactions eff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Program Coordinator or Program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Program Coordinator or Program Manager, you need strong organizational, project management, and problem-solving skills, typically supported by a bachelor's degree in a relevant field. Familiarity with project management software (like Asana, Trello, or MS Project) and certifications such as PMP or CAPM are often advantageous. Excellent communication, leadership, and adaptability are vital soft skills for effectively managing teams and stakeholders. These skills ensure efficient program execution, stakeholder satisfaction, and the achievement of organizational objectives.

What is the difference between Program Coordinator Program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ectProgram Coordinator Program ManagerProject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ree; certifications like PMP or PgMP are commonUsually requires a bachelor's degree; certifications are less common
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ple projects within a program, often in organizational or corporate settingsSupports specific projects, often within a team or department
ResponsibilitiesManages program goals, coordinates projects, aligns resources, and reports to stakeholdersAssists with project tasks, schedules, and communication, focusing on individual project deliverables

The Program Coordinator Program Manager role involves overseeing multiple projects within a program, requiring strategic coordination and higher-level management skills. In contrast, a Project Coordinator focuses on supporting specific projects, handling day-to-day tasks.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but the Program Coordinator Program Manager typically has broader responsibilities and a higher level of oversight.
